Electrical power supply

Working with electrical current could cause serious risk of bodily 
injury, therefore:
• Before starting work on the pump, switch off the power and 

secure it against reconnection.

• Do not bend or clamp power cable or expose it to heat 

sources.

• Do not immerse the pump in water or other liquids or expose 

it to spray water or moisture.

Rotating components

The pump contains rotating components that are exposed if the 
pump housing is open or the coupling guard is missing. Touching 
the rotating components can cause serious injury, therefore:
• Before opening the pump housing, switch off the motor and 

secure against reconnection.

• Never switch on the motor when the pump housing is open or 

the coupling guard is missing.

• Never operate the pump without the coupling guard.

High Deadweight

The pump has a very high deadweight, depending on the model. 
If the pump is dropped or it falls, there is a risk of death by crush-
ing if pump falls, therefore:
• Exercise caution when lifting or transporting.
• Never walk under suspended loads.
• Always put the pump and pump parts down ensuring they 

cannot tip over.

• Only use the transportation methods described in these 

operating instructions

• Before loosening screws, secure the pump parts to be 

loosened to prevent them from falling.
